Description
Ceci is a decent buyout option if the Oilers want to reshape their D core. Moving him would require some assets which are better served improving the roster.

Here are the cap hits:

23/24 - 83K
24/25 - 1.083M
25/26 - 1.33 M
26/27 - 1.33M

Virtually no cap hit in the first year, and hopefully once the cap increases are more significant, the remaining three years won't hinder the team much.
